Banani

AI UI design tool that generates app screens and prototypes from prompts.

Pros

  • +Generates app screen mockups directly from text prompts
  • +Speeds up early-stage prototyping work
  • +Useful for quickly visualizing app design concepts

Cons

  • Generated screens often need design refinement
  • Less control over fine visual details compared to manual design tools

Kombai

AI tool that converts Figma designs into clean, production-ready frontend code.

Pros

  • +Converts Figma designs into clean, production-ready code
  • +Reduces manual coding work after design handoff
  • +Aims for maintainable code output rather than messy auto-generated markup

Cons

  • Complex or highly custom designs may still need manual adjustment
  • Newer entrant in the increasingly crowded design-to-code space
